Taschenbuch. Zustand: Neu. Neuware - How to Save the Whole Blinkin' Planet is an energising adventure into electricity and science led by superhero engineer, Captain Kilowatt. Accompany the Captain on a mission to find the many ways that our daily lives are powered now and zap yourself into the future of energy to save the blinkin' planet. Captain Kilowatt zaps readers from their everyday activities whether eating breakfast, playing a video game, or taking the bus to school, into the world of power, circuits, batteries and buzzing electrons. Power up your brains! Along the way readers can level up their energy know-how through quick quizzes, shocking facts and zappology 101 (the science of energy). Each new chapter presents an opportunity to get hands-on with the science behind the energy source by scanning a QR code to unlock a virtual activity. Zustand: Good. [23] leaves of text and 20 colour engravings each with tissue guard. (4to) 32.5x24 cm (12¾ x 9½") period three-quarter blue morocco and marbled boards, spine gilt, raised bands, all edges gilt. Edges worn, front hinge open; paper a bit toned but overall internally near fine.Henry Vizetelly, Printer and engraver, Gough Square, Fleet Street"Plates engraved by Louis Marvy; after Sir Augustus Wall Callcott, J.M.W. Turner, J. Holland, Francis Danby, Thomas Creswick, William Collins, Richard Redgrave, Frederick Richard Lee, George Cattermole, William James Mu?ller, James Duffield Harding, Peter Nasmyth, Richard Wilson, Edward William Cooke, John Constable, Peter De Wint, David Cox, Thomas Gainsborough, David Roberts, and Clarkson Stanfield. Each plate is followed by a short critique by Thackeray. Thackeray was an old friend of Marvy, a French artist, who took refuge in London after the chaos of 1848. Theodore Taylor's 1864 biography of Thackeray mentions the history of the book: "A fine and skillful landscape painter himself, M. Marvy, while here, as a means of earning a living, made a series of engravings after the works of our English landscape painters. The publishers, however, would not undertake the work without a series of letter-press notices of each picture from Thackeray; and the latter accordingly added some criticisms which are interesting as developing his theory of this kind of art" (p.32). An interesting and quite scarce Thackeray item, very rarely found colored.Abbey, Life in England, no 207 : "The majority of the copies issued were uncoloured.".
